Output 840cba2368e8a3218b63a3119c565cc9261302e263067d434b160c8817fc5e3b:0
- value
- 343709070
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9451eecd2a92b4431e9786c0294a0e24ae230af2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EXFABcHpmfvRaSj7EoNQf3b3D6axG7Fsz
- transaction
- 840cba2368e8a3218b63a3119c565cc9261302e263067d434b160c8817fc5e3b
- confirmations
- 459531
- spent
- true